Finally getting the data logging finalized and was given the OK to do a WOT. My set up is:

Stage II with 4.75" pulley
ID1050X injectors
Thermal R&D axle back
PBD remote tune

As expected the lower rev band is like stock, i.e. predictable and easy to drive. Once you hit around 4,500 rpm, it turns loose and pulls very hard. With the A10, you can be in boost in about 1 second at just about any speed or rpm.

Going to take some time to adjust to the new set up since I have driven this car for the past 2 years basically stock.

What surprised me was I did one WOT, starting from 45 mph, was very cool at about 48 degrees ambient. I have Firestone Indy 500, 255/40/19's with excellent tread.

Rear end broke loose when I hit it. Holy smokes, are you kidding?

Looks like more and stickier rubber is in my future.

How much timing are you seeing? When I first started I was only getting 13-14 deg on our terrible 91 octane here in Az. Now with the methanol I'm seeing 19ish and it's a HUGE difference. Agreed that when you leave the car in manual mode and mash it and it drops to 4th gear the car can be a handful on street tires. It's fun, but you have to be ready for it!

Get a set of Mickey thompson street ss’s 285’s or 305’s when it gets warm again. They’ll dead hook from a dig at your hp rating..later on look into a stall speed converter. They work well with centrifical Sc’s..

I'm not sure how much pulley down I can go before I need to upgrade the fuel system. I understand up to around 650 whp I should be OK, but pushing 700 it's time to look at fueling alternatives.
